Miniature-Like Tilt Shift Photograph for Inspirations and Tutorials

Miniature-Like Tilt Shift Photograph for Inspirations and Tutorials

“Tilt-shift photography” refers to the use of camera movements on small- and medium-format cameras, and sometimes specifically refers to the use of tilt for selective focus, often for simulating aminiature scene. Sometimes the term is used when the shallow depth of field is simulated with digital postprocessing; the name may derive from the tilt-shift lens normally required [...]
